An Interview with Pastor Yuan Zhi-ming

[…] Johnson. In the 1980's Yuan Zhi-ming was a documentary film-maker in China. Because of his involvement in the 1989 protest movement, he was forced to flee China, eventually ending up in the United States. He became a Christian in 1992, and started the China Soul for Christ Foundation, which produced the documentary <em>The Cross: Jesus in China.</em></p>

Goodbye, SARA

<p>The State Administration of Religious Affairs (SARA) will be absorbed by the Party’s United Front Work Department.</p>
